news 2026/5/8 7:29:37

Vue 3二维码组件终极使用指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Vue 3二维码组件终极使用指南

Vue 3二维码组件终极使用指南

【免费下载链接】vue-qrcode项目地址: https://gitcode.com/gh_mirrors/vue/vue-qrcode

Vue-QRcode是一个专为Vue 3设计的二维码生成组件,基于成熟的node-qrcode库构建,让开发者能够轻松在项目中集成二维码功能。本指南将帮助您快速掌握这个组件的使用方法。

快速安装配置

环境准备与安装

首先确保您的项目使用Vue 3,然后选择合适的包管理器进行安装:

npm用户:

npm install vue@3 qrcode@1 @chenfengyuan/vue-qrcode@2

pnpm用户:

pnpm add vue@3 qrcode@1 @chenfengyuan/vue-qrcode@2

Yarn用户:

yarn add vue@3 qrcode@1 @chenfengyuan/vue-qrcode@2

核心功能详解

基础使用示例

在Vue项目中注册组件后,即可在模板中使用:

<vue-qrcode value="Hello, World!" :options="{ width: 200 }"></vue-qrcode>

组件属性配置

Vue-QRcode组件提供三个核心属性:

  • value:二维码编码的字符串内容
  • options:二维码生成选项,支持宽度、颜色等配置
  • tag:渲染标签类型,支持canvas、img、svg三种格式

常见问题解决方案

二维码显示异常排查

当二维码无法正常显示时,请检查以下配置:

  1. 确认value属性已正确设置
  2. 验证options中的宽度、高度参数是否合法
  3. 确保Vue 3和qrcode依赖版本兼容

版本兼容性问题

如果您仍在Vue 2项目中,需要切换到组件的v1分支进行兼容。Vue 3项目请使用最新版本。

高级配置技巧

自定义二维码样式

通过options参数可以深度定制二维码外观:

<vue-qrcode value="https://example.com" :options="{ width: 300, color: { dark: '#000000', light: '#ffffff' } }"> </vue-qrcode>

多种输出格式选择

组件支持三种渲染方式:

  • canvas:默认选项,性能最佳
  • img:图片格式,兼容性最好
  • svg:矢量格式,缩放不失真

项目结构说明

Vue-QRcode项目采用TypeScript开发,主要源码文件位于src/index.ts。测试用例覆盖了组件的事件和属性功能,确保代码质量。

通过本指南,您已经掌握了Vue-QRcode组件的核心使用方法。这个轻量级组件将帮助您快速在Vue 3项目中集成二维码功能,提升用户体验。

【免费下载链接】vue-qrcode项目地址: https://gitcode.com/gh_mirrors/vue/vue-qrcode

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/3 7:01:46

终极Mac菜单栏整理神器:Ice让你的工作效率翻倍提升

终极Mac菜单栏整理神器&#xff1a;Ice让你的工作效率翻倍提升 【免费下载链接】Ice Powerful menu bar manager for macOS 项目地址: https://gitcode.com/GitHub_Trending/ice/Ice 还在为杂乱的Mac菜单栏烦恼吗&#xff1f;面对拥挤不堪的图标排列&#xff0c;想要快速…

作者头像 李华
网站建设 2026/5/2 21:04:24

Kotaemon框架的性能调优技巧汇总

Kotaemon框架的性能调优技巧汇总 在构建企业级智能对话系统时&#xff0c;我们常常遇到这样的困境&#xff1a;明明使用了最先进的大语言模型&#xff0c;回答却依然“似是而非”——要么答非所问&#xff0c;要么引用过时信息&#xff0c;甚至在多轮交互中彻底丢失上下文。这背…

作者头像 李华
网站建设 2026/4/27 15:22:51

基于Kotaemon的智能助手开发全流程演示

基于Kotaemon的智能助手开发全流程解析 在企业纷纷拥抱大模型的时代&#xff0c;一个现实问题日益凸显&#xff1a;通用语言模型虽然能“说人话”&#xff0c;但面对专业领域的复杂查询时&#xff0c;常常给出看似合理却漏洞百出的回答。比如银行客服系统里&#xff0c;若AI把“…

作者头像 李华
网站建设 2026/5/1 11:07:19

Kotaemon如何支持图文混排的内容生成?

Kotaemon如何支持图文混排的内容生成&#xff1f; 在企业级智能对话系统日益复杂的今天&#xff0c;用户早已不满足于“只听不说”的纯文本问答。无论是客服场景中的流程图指引、金融投顾里的趋势图表展示&#xff0c;还是教育辅导中对知识点的可视化拆解&#xff0c;“既说又示…

作者头像 李华
网站建设 2026/5/8 0:04:07

Kotaemon在垂直领域知识问答中的应用案例分析

Kotaemon在垂直领域知识问答中的应用案例分析 在金融、医疗和企业服务等专业领域&#xff0c;智能问答系统早已不再是简单的“关键词匹配模板回复”工具。随着大语言模型&#xff08;LLM&#xff09;的普及&#xff0c;用户期待的是能够理解复杂语义、提供精准答案、甚至主动完…

作者头像 李华
网站建设 2026/5/8 0:26:42

Kotaemon如何帮助中小企业低成本构建AI能力?

Kotaemon如何帮助中小企业低成本构建AI能力&#xff1f; 在企业智能化浪潮席卷各行各业的今天&#xff0c;越来越多的中小企业开始尝试引入大语言模型&#xff08;LLM&#xff09;来提升客户服务效率、优化内部知识管理。然而现实往往骨感&#xff1a;高昂的算力成本、复杂的系…

作者头像 李华